In the “Green Transition at Play” report we are unpacking social and environmental sustainability in the European video and board game industries. The report provides a systematic overview of diverse sustainability-related information: underpinning frameworks, guidelines and initiatives, EU policies, design tools and green games. The aim of this work is to better understand the current fragmented picture around sustainability issues in the context of games.
